What are disappearing messages in WhatsApp and how to enable them - in detail?
Disappearing Messages is a feature in WhatsApp designed to enhance user privacy by automatically deleting messages after a specified duration. This functionality ensures that conversations remain confidential, as the content of the chat will no longer be accessible once the time limit expires. The feature can be particularly useful for sensitive information or when users wish to maintain a cleaner and more organized chat history.
To enable Disappearing Messages in WhatsApp, follow these detailed steps:
- Open WhatsApp: Launch the WhatsApp application on your mobile device.
- Access Chat Settings: Navigate to the chat where you want to activate Disappearing Messages. For individual chats, tap on the contact's name at the top of the screen. For group chats, tap on the group name or icon.
- Enable Disappearing Messages: Depending on your device and WhatsApp version, you may see an option labeled "Disappearing Messages" directly in the chat settings. Tap on it to enable the feature. If you do not see this option, proceed to the next step.
- Change Chat Settings: Look for a menu item that says "Chat Settings," "Group Info," or similar. Tap on it.
- Activate Disappearing Messages: In the settings menu, find and tap on "Disappearing Messages." You will be prompted to choose a duration for which messages will be visible before they disappear. Options typically include 24 hours, 7 days, or 90 days. Select your preferred duration.
- Confirmation: WhatsApp will ask you to confirm your choice. Tap on "OK" or "Enable" to finalize the setting. Once activated, a timer icon will appear in the chat header, indicating that Disappearing Messages is enabled.
It's important to note that while Disappearing Messages provides an added layer of privacy, it does not guarantee complete security. Recipients can still screenshot or forward messages before they disappear. Additionally, if a user is not connected to the internet within the specified duration, the message may remain until they are back online.
